Understanding the Driving License Categories
Before diving into the application process, it's vital to comprehend the various types of driving licenses offered. The classifications can vary a little depending on the nation, however typically, they consist of:
Learner's Permit: This is the initial stage for new chauffeurs. It allows people to practice driving under the guidance of a licensed driver.Provisional License: Also referred to as a probationary license, this is provided to new chauffeurs who have actually passed their driving test however are still subject to particular limitations.Full Driver's License: This is the last, where all limitations are lifted, and the driver is fully accredited to operate an automobile separately.Step-by-Step Guide to Obtaining a Driving LicenseStep 1: Meet the Eligibility Requirements
The first action in getting a driving license is to ensure you satisfy the eligibility requirements. These generally consist of:
Age Requirement: Most countries need applicants to be a minimum of 16 years old to look for a learner's permit and 18 years of ages for a full chauffeur's license.Residency: You should be a homeowner of the state or nation where you are obtaining the license.Vision Test: You might need to pass a vision test to ensure you have appropriate vision for safe driving.Step 2: Study the Driver's Handbook
Before getting a student's authorization, it's crucial to study the chauffeur's handbook. This handbook covers traffic laws, roadway indications, and safe driving practices. A lot of states offer the handbook online or at local DMV workplaces.
Action 3: Apply for a Learner's Permit
To get a learner's permit, you will require to:
Visit the DMV: Go to your local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or their website to use.Offer Documentation: Bring the needed files, which normally consist of evidence of identity, residency, and date of birth.Pass the Written Test: Take and pass the written test, which examines your knowledge of traffic laws and safe driving practices.Pay the Fee: Pay the application cost, which differs by state.Step 4: Practice Driving
As soon as you have your student's authorization, it's time to start practicing. You need to drive under the guidance of a certified driver who is at least 21 years of ages. It's suggested to practice in a variety of driving conditions, including daytime, nighttime, and different weather condition conditions.
Step 5: Schedule and Pass the Driving Test
After acquiring adequate driving experience, you can arrange your driving test. The test normally consists of:
Pre-Trip Inspection: Inspect the lorry for safety issues.Driving Skills: Demonstrate your ability to drive safely, follow traffic laws, and perform particular maneuvers such as parallel parking and turning.Post-Trip Evaluation: Answer any concerns the inspector might have about your driving.Step 6: Obtain Your Driver's License
If you pass the driving test, you will receive a provisionary license instantly. You can then apply for a complete driver's license after a specified period, which varies by state. Some states may require extra tests or classes before providing a complete license.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does it take to get a chauffeur's license?

A: The process can take numerous months, depending upon how rapidly you complete each step. It usually takes a couple of weeks to study and pass the composed test, and after that numerous months to acquire enough driving experience before taking the driving test.

Q2: Can I take the written test numerous times if I stop working?

A: Yes, you can retake the composed test. However, there may be a waiting duration and a fee for each effort.

Q3: What takes place if I fail the driving test?

A: If you stop working the driving test, you can retake it after a defined waiting period. It's an excellent idea to take extra driving lessons or practice more before retaking the test.

Q4: Can I utilize a learner's permit to drive alone?

A: No, a learner's authorization just permits you to drive under the guidance of a licensed motorist who is at least 21 years old.

Q5: What are the limitations for a provisional license?

A: Restrictions can differ by state but might consist of constraints on driving at night, restrictions on the variety of passengers, and requirements for a zero-tolerance policy for alcohol.
